# Flaky Integration Tests — PayLoom

Flaky tests in the PayLoom integration suite: retry once. Still failing? Check the quarantine list on the Ledgerline wiki. Quarantined tests are not your problem. Non-quarantined failures blocking a payments deploy go to the Settlement Platform team. For anything urgent during on-call hours, contact the suite owners directly.

escalation mailbox, bafog-fafog: ulador@paliqlabs.internal

**Vendor note: Inkmill markdown pipeline**

Rendering for Parchway docs is outsourced to Inkmill under an annual contract, renewing each March. They handle sanitization and PDF export; we own the upload queue. SLA: 4-hour response on rendering failures. Escalate only after two failed retries. Their support desk is reachable at the address below.

billing contact of hahaf-baguf = zorael.tammir.jorius@sivrelhq.internal

Ticket: Staging env misconfigured for Siftgate bloom filter

The bloom layer in front of the Pellet KV store is rejecting all lookups in staging because the env file was copied from the dev template without credentials. False-positive tuning values are fine; only the auth line is missing. To unblock the weekly demo, the Pellet admission secret must be set on the following line.

env line for yaguf-fajop: LEDGER_TOKEN13=fb08984397349

MEMO — Kettling Depot Receiving

Uniform sets for the new Kettling depot arrive Wednesday via Ashgrove courier: 40 boxes, sorted by size, manifest attached to box one. Check the count at the dock before signing; shortages go straight to stores, not the courier. The hand-over instruction the courier will follow is set out below.

drop instructions, tafof-baguf: the holmir gilox courier leaves the sormir ulaok holdor ledger at gate 5596 under passcode 257343